OpenAI’s flip-flop will not get Elon Musk off its back

Call it a rare win for Elon Musk.

The world’s richest man, whose business empire has lately taken a beating, has long pursued a vendetta against Sam Altman, boss of OpenAI.

In recent months Mr Musk, who helped found the artificial-intelligence (AI) lab but left in 2018, has sought to block its proposed conversion into a for-profit company through various methods, including an unsolicited (and unsuccessful) $97bn bid for the assets of the non-profit entity that controls it.
